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ef (80/20 for juiciness)
- 3 cups cooked white or brown rice
- 2 green onions, thinly sliced
- 1 tablespoon toasted sesame seeds (optional)
Seasonings & Flavor Boosters
- 3 tablespoons so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ated
- 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es (adjust to taste)
Optional Toppings
- Julienned carrots
- Shredded cabbage
- Sriracha sauce
- Fresh cilantro
Instructions
How to Make Flavorful Korean Ground Beef Bowls For Weeknights
- Prepare the s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, brown sugar, s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and red pepper flakes.
- Cook the beef: Heat a large skillet over medium heat. Add ground beef and cook, breaking up with a spoon, until fully browned and no longer pink, about 7-8 minutes. Drain excess fat if necessary.
- Add the sauce: Pour the prepared sauce over the cooked beef. Stir to coat and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ly and beef is well glazed.
- Assemble bowls: Spoon cooked rice into bowls. Top with flavored beef, sliced green onions, sesame seeds, and any optional toppings you prefer. Serve warm.
